Important safety information
• Follow the safety information in the operating instructions for your
tumble dryer. If necessary, take into consideration the advice of your
local chimney sweep or of local authorities.
• The dryer must not be installed in a room where the temperature can
fall below zero or is higher than + 35°C.
• The dryer must be positioned horizontally.
• If the appliance is installed near a gas, coal or electric heater, an insu-
lating not-inflammable panel must be inserted between the dryer
and the heater (size: 85x57.5 cm).
• The dryer’s exhaust must not be fed into a cooker hood, or a chimney or
flue pipe designed to carry the exhaust from a fuel burning appliance.
• For correct ventilation of the room, avoid the formation of low pressure.
